500 HP, what engine D13? I'd advice you not to have top power version of D13. The problem is that this kind of engines has too hot exaust, becouse no reason to limit exaust temperature on DEF engines (anyway zero NOx). But if you run this engine constantly at full output exaust valves life is limited and I wanna remind you that D13 is rear end geartrain and it not easy to remove install cyl head on cabovers and really difficult on conventionals. To acess rear end of engine mechnics have to remove hatch and work on it from cab (in greezy jeans, LOL).
Imo, 465 ore 480 HP rating is better.
New Cummins ISX XPI is better for 500-650 HP FH and VN trucks, but... XPI is too suffisticated system for us -
man, my advice 465 HP and if you wanna auto ATO2612 I-shift, this is the best I-shift offered by Volvo, really durable
